Clear Creek Tennis Sweeps Fannin

Uncategorized

The Clear Creek Middle School tennis team traveled to Blue Ridge last Wednesday, with the Bobcats and Lady Cats serving a sweep to Fannin.

In girls singles matches, Emma Callihan bested Peyton Peugh 8-2. Hope Colwell downed Emma Mitchell 8-0, while Ellie Teague won a hard-fought 8-7 affair over Abbey Smith.

Girls doubles matches featured Josie Reece and Sarah Sheahan beating Jodie Collins and Brooke Patton 8-2, while the duo of Alexis Sirmans and Morgan White defeated Payton Rogers and Elizabeth Key 8-7.

In exhibition girls doubles action, Hannah Walker and Jessica Futch bested Rylie Mason and Rogers 8-0 and the combination of Lark Reece and Kimberly Holt beat LeAnn and Lindsey Twigs 8-0.

Brady Sanford won an 8-3 boys singles match over Jake Jones, while Kaden Reece beat Jalen Ingram 8-1. A boys doubles match saw Luke Wimpey and Braden Jenkins hand Jones and Ingram an 8-1 loss.

The 5-0 Lady Cats victory puts the Clear Creek girls at 2-1 for the year, while the 3-0 Bobcats triumph leaves the Clear Creek boys at an unblemished 3-0 record for the season.

CCMS will host Lumpkin at Gilmer High School today at 4 p.m., before journeying to Pickens for another match tomorrow.
